When can I watch Doctor Who season 2 episode 1 in the US?
Doctor Who's second season will make its Disney+ debut on Saturday, April 12 at 12AM PT / 3AM ET. That's the same time that the first season of Gatwa's 15th Doctor premiered on one of the world's best streaming services, so it makes sense that this season's first chapter would air then, too.
What is the release date and time for Doctor Who season 15 episode 1 in the UK?
Doctor Who season 15 will premiere on BBC iPlayer in the UK on Saturday, April 12 at 8AM BST. If you can't watch the series' next entry until that evening, you'll be able to catch it on BBC One at 6:50PM.
With Doctor Who being rebooted in the UK back in 2005, it has a different seasonal moniker to other territories. Indeed, the forthcoming installment is known as Doctor Who season 2 internationally due to the deal made between the BBC and Disney to bring the legendary show to Disney+ last year.
However, because Doctor Who has aired on the BBC's flagship terrestrial channel since its inception, the Gatwa era is viewed as a direct continuation of the TV show's 21st century reboot. As such, this installment is known as season 15 on British shores.

What is the launch date and time for the Doctor Who season 2 premiere in Australia?
'The Robot Revolution' will air in Australia on Saturday, April 12 at 5pm AEST. Just as it does in the US – and every nation outside of the UK – one of the best Disney+ shows will, well, be available to watch on that streaming platform Down Under.
Doctor Who season 2 full release schedule

New episodes of Doctor Who's sophomore outing will be released every Saturday. For a complete rundown of when to expect their arrival in the US, UK, and Australia in particular, read on:
- Doctor Who season 2 episode 1 – Saturday, April 12
- Doctor Who season 2 episode 2 – Saturday, April 19
- Doctor Who season 2 episode 3 – Saturday, April 26
- Doctor Who season 2 episode 4 – Saturday, May 3
- Doctor Who season 2 episode 5 – Saturday, May 10
- Doctor Who season 2 episode 6 – Saturday, May 17
- Doctor Who season 2 episode 7 – Saturday, May 24
- Doctor Who season 2 episode 8 – Saturday, May 31
